Shopping malls database
Hot Dog On A Stick - Coronado Center, Louisiana & Menaul Blvd.
Albuquerque, NM 87110
Store name: Hot Dog On A Stick
Address: Louisiana & Menaul Blvd.
Albuquerque, NM 87110
Shopping mall: Coronado Center
State: NM
Location: Albuquerque